Worldwide / United States / Lockhart, TX / Environment Issues

Lockhart, TX Environment Issues

Compliance Resources Inc

Compliance Resources Inc

1010 Fir Ln., Lockhart, 78644
512-398-9858
View detail page - Compliance Resources Inc
TCG

TCG

1204 Reed Dr., Lockhart, 78644
512-398-2145
View detail page - TCG
Page 1